11-4 Thinking and LanguageOnline version

P.4.11 Describe language development in humans.

by Lance Hiles
1

All children around the world would go through _____ _____ of language development , if Noam Chomsky's theory is correct.

  
  
2

Since babies acquire language faster than other skills, Noam Chomsky argued that babies have an _____ _____ to learn language. It is inherited from their parents.

  
  
3

When a baby makes sounds like an adult, that behavior is reinforced through _____ and _____ , according to B.F. Skinner. This is how behaviorists explain language development.

  
  
4

If a patient has _____ problems, a researcher can use a Magnetic Resonance Image machine and locate the region of the brain that is affected, then compare those findings to the brain of a healthy person.

5

The meaning of words based on their context is referred to as _____ , which is why the word "lie" can mean falsehood or resting position.

6

The rules for sentence structure differ between languages (such as Spanish and English), and we call these rules _____ .

7

“Tag” & “Dis-” are examples of a _____ , which is the smallest unit of meaning in ANY language.

8

The smallest unit of sound in ANY language is a _____ , and there are one hundred different types, including ALL vowels and consonants.

9

Language is used to express emotion & solve problems, but the most familiar function of language is to communicate ideas and facts, or the most familiar function is _____ .

10

We use language when we are _____ , or problem solving, or just talking internally to ourselves. .

11

_____ takes place in all languages around the world, regardless of culture, and it is the first stage of language development.

12

Deaf children learn to babble by using _____ _____ , just like children who can hear learn to babble by using sounds.

  
  
13

66% of children grow up bilingual in the world, and they learn their two languages just as quickly as a child who learns one _____ .

14

The Gardners taught Washoe one hundred and sixty American _____ _____ signs , even though Washoe only had the mental skills of a two-year old human.

  
  
15

Chimpanzees cannot use _____ rules, while humans use these regularly and without effort. Chimpanzees can, however, use symbols in language.

16

Our language can affect our perception of the _____ _____ , at least Benjamin Whorf thought so. He believed that people who speak Japanese think differently than people who speak German.

  
  
17

Americans have many words for the concept of "time" because the concept of "time" is very important in a capitalist society. This is an example of language influencing thoughts, otherwise known as _____ _____ .

  
  
18

Russian & German use nouns that are neuter, and French, Spanish, & Italian have feminine & masculine nouns. These are examples of a language using grammatical _____ .

19

It is curious that _____ are not differentiated by sex in the English language, while parents, siblings, aunts/uncles, and grandparents are differentiated by sex.

20

You are more capable of keeping track of where you are, if you are a speaker of _____ direction languages, rather than a speaker of relative terms languages.
